Dubai Donates AED20m to Fight Child Hunger

Under the directives of His Highness Sheikh Ahmed bin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Second Deputy Ruler of Dubai and Supreme Chairman of the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um Charitable Establishment, the Establishment has donated AED 20 million to the “Edge of Life” campaign.

The campaign was launched during the Holy Month of Ramadan by His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ice President and Prime Minister of the UAE and Ruler of Dubai. It aims to raise at least AED 1 billion to support global efforts to fight childhood hunger and save five million children from malnutrition.

Inspired by Humanitarian Vision

Sheikh Ahmed bin Mohammed said the campaign reflects the humanitarian vision of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um. He added that helping underprivileged communities and ensuring children have access to proper nutrition is a key priority.

He said that giving and kindness are important values in the UAE’s national identity. The campaign, he noted, marks a major step in global efforts to fight child hunger through partnerships with leading international organisations.

A Noble Humanitarian Initiative

His Excellency Abdulla Al Basti, Secretary General of The Executive Council of Dubai and Chairman of the Board of Trustees of the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um Charitable Establishment, described the campaign as a noble initiative.

He said the Establishment’s AED 20 million contribution shows its strong commitment to supporting all Ramadan humanitarian campaigns launched by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id. He stressed that childhood hunger is an urgent global issue that needs immediate and joint action.

Previous Ramadan Campaigns

The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um Charitable Establishment has also supported previous major Ramadan food aid initiatives, including:

  • 10 Million Meals

  • 100 Million Meals

  • One Billion Meals

  • 1 Billion Meals Endowment

  • Mothers’ Endowment (2024)

  • Fathers’ Endowment (2025)

These initiatives have strengthened the UAE’s position as a global leader in humanitarian work.

Global Partnerships

The “Edge of Life” campaign is organised in partnership with:

  • UNICEF

  • Save the Children

  • Children's Investment Fund Foundation

  • Action Against Hunger

The campaign focuses on children in the world’s most vulnerable communities. According to global statistics, five children under the age of five die every minute due to hunger and malnutrition. The campaign aims to address this urgent humanitarian crisis.
